POSITION: CENTER ADMINISTRATOR/RECEPTIONIST

DEPARTMENT: ADMINISTRATION

REPORTS TO: CENTER COORDINATOR

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Coordinate Center activities and operations to secure efficiency and compliance to company policies
  • Meeting & greeting clients/customers in a warm, friendly manner.
  • Supervise administrative staff and divide responsibilities to ensure performance ( Drivers, Security Guards, Cleaners)
  • Manage phone calls and correspondence (e-mail, letters, packages etc.)
  • Maintaining a clean and enjoyable working environment
  • Organizing, arranging and coordinating meetings
  • Track stocks of office supplies and place orders when necessary
  • Act as primary liaison between the company, staff, and beneficiaries, providing information, answering questions, and responding to request
  • Assist colleagues whenever necessary

About Mercy USA

Mercy-USA for Aid and Development is dedicated to alleviating human suffering and supporting individuals and their communities in their efforts to become more self-sufficient. Incorporated in the State of Michigan in 1988, Mercy-USA’s projects focus on improving health, nutrition and access to safe water, as well as promoting economic and educational growth around the world.
